2013-05-03 186 views
0

根据这些文档:https://developers.facebook.com/blog/post/2013/04/03/new-apis-for-comment-replies/https://developers.facebook.com/docs/reference/api/Comment/,我应该能够通过{object_i}/comments获得一篇文章的评论和回复{comment_id}/commnetsFacebook的评论API

前者的作品,但后者没有。

例如:http://graph.facebook.com/10151655724337952/comments,但不是http://graph.facebook.com/10151655724337952_10460030/comments

对象http://graph.facebook.com/10151655724337952_10460030没问题。

原帖:https://www.facebook.com/photo.php?fbid=10151655724337952&set=a.114456157951.118433.8062627951&type=1

我错过了什么?

+0

UPDATE:获得在应对家长的答复包括过滤器=流。 – Azat 2013-05-03 18:48:21

回答

1

{comment_id}/comments连接需要有效的访问令牌。这很奇怪(因为父注释不需要它),但是如果您提供访问令牌,则可以检索响应。

这些调用中最有可能有一个被文档定义的访问令牌限制。这发生在其他几个连接上,基本上最终成为文档或API响应中的矛盾。

(我将离开这件事给Facebook Bug的团队找出@ _ @)

+0

好的,谢谢。所以这基本上是Facebook API中的一个错误?嗯。 – Azat 2013-05-03 18:49:00

0

您可以通过在{object_id}/comments呼叫中添加注释字段来获得答复,如documentation中所述。但正如文档和@phwd指出的那样:

此调用需要与Comment对象相同的权限。它也将具有与顶级/评论调用相同结构的响应。